Farah breaks English record but misses out on London Marathon victory

Mo Farah's London Marathon debut proved tricky as he finished a respectable eight but missed the British record he had targeted.

A double Olympic champion in 5,000m and 10,000m, Farah, had already stated this was the toughest test of his career, and so it proved as the 31-year-old finished in 2:08:21, more than four minutes behind winner Wilson Kipsang.

The Kenyan world record took the title in an unofficial time of two hours four minutes and 29 seconds, a course record.

Farah's time did break the English record but finished outside Steve Jones' 29-year-old British record of 2:07:13.
